In my own personal experiences, I’ve learned ( mostly the hard way, I admit ) that those times of “burn out” can only fully be restored and refreshed when I go to the right source. Not the easiest source, always, as I tend to want to vent first to a friend, or scream at my cat, or overreact to my family, or some other activity that is fruitless.

Though we can’t often control the degree of the “heat” (those “ Heated” pressures and concerns that literally dry up our “bones” ) we can, I’ve found, “insulate” ourselves by taking some early morning time, to rest by the Still, Refreshing Waters of Gods Word, and to drink in the life giving refreshment before facing the inevitable and unforeseen searing heat of the days we will face.

When our Daughter was small we taught her, (probably as you have as well) when crossing the street, to STOP, LOOK, AND LISTEN ( for impending danger) . What good advice for us, in facing the heat of the day, as we:

· STOP Find a place and a time to hesitate, preferable early in the morning before the HEAT of our day begins, sit down quietly and rest, and refocus on the Source of Life, just BASK in His glory…you don’t have to do much else, as HE is ready and able to do what is needed from this point.

· LOOK …. look up, Psalm 123 tells us this, and when we look UP, rather than down at what is facing us, we can see that all around us is the evidence of the handiwork of the Master Architect, who created everything we see, for His Pleasure, and our enjoyment. He is the one who created US, to commune intimately with, and be refreshed by HIS strength, and not our own, (or worse, some foreign substance that is only temporary) and remember as you LOOK UP, that HE is the TRUE Time Keeper of life, and when we let HIM orchestrate our time schedule, and “insulate” us, we will endure the heat of the day so much better

AND THEN, we must…………………
· LISTEN … That means, don’t talk!!!, and trust me when I tell you, this is a challenging one for me, as I am quite a talker … but, just wait, with His Word sitting right in front of you, Is always a good thing ,…and just let his spirit speak to your soul, and to guide and direct you to the very spot that you need, for the very tasks that this new day will hold !!

Most all of us are familiar with Psalm 23, the shepherds Psalm… which is one of my earliest memory verses, but have you ever stopped to realize that it says “He maketh me” to lie down in Green ( restful, restorative, nourishing) Pastures, and Not that .. He “ leteth me” lie down? Sometimes, I just keep on pressing on, trying to handle, balance and endure the heat in my life.

Maybe it could be, I’m thinkin’, that He is allowing the impending “searing heat” of the day ahead, to drive us to lie down, and look to the One who comforts, protects and restores our body, mind and souls. Maybe we don’t need to run and hide, or turn to something ( or someone) that never fully satisfies, and just maybe we can keep those old “DO NOT DISTURB" Signs in the drawer, because when our hearts are fixed on him, it’s only then, that we are truly at Peace and Rest and ready to face the day, under the Shadow of His Wings, where, no matter how hot they day gets, we will be sheltered.

Well, I think I am ready to face the day now, and hope you will be too. Knowing that whatever degree the temperature reaches, we can withstand it. And, I pray that each of us will remember confidently that, no matter what we face this hour, day, or week, we will never face it unarmed, unprotected or without strength, if we come to the Source of Living Water before attempting to face the heat of the day :

Ps 23 NIV : The Lord is my Shepherd, protector, defender, and RESTORER of my soul
Ps 92: 13-14 The Righteous SHALL flourish, in the courts of the Lord, still bear fruit in old age, and be FRESH and Green.
Jer 17:8 ( we will be like) A Tree planted by the water, who sends out roots and WILL NOT WITHER in the Heat of the day!!
